A federal government website … WebThe base charge for the Part B benefit will be $170.10 per month next year, as opposed to $148.50 this year. Individuals with higher incomes will pay more, as seen in the chart below. At the top end, those making $500,000 or more will pay $578.30. The Part B deductible will increase from $203 to $233 in 2024. Whether these increases will cause ...

Web26 de dez. de 2024 · Medicare Plan G is a type of insurance offered through Medicare. It pays for most of the costs associated with Medicare Part A and Part B, such as hospital care, doctor visits, and certain lab tests. It also covers some additional services, including preventive care. Pros of Medicare Plan G. No deductibles or copayments for Part A or …
